TL;DR
Lead Inventory Coordinator (2nd Shift) (Inventory Management/ERP): Oversees inventory operations and leads employees in a manufacturing plant with an accent on stock transfers, cycle counts, ERP transactions, and material staging. Focus on resolving inventory discrepancies, maintaining stock accuracy, auditing transactions, and coordinating material flow for manufacturing jobs.

Location: Fontana, California, United States; onsite in a manufacturing plant

Salary: $21.61–$29.18 per hour

Company

Manufacturing operations supporting the design, production, and delivery of products, with the Cloud and Power Infrastructure segment planned to become Axiom.

What you will do

  • Oversee inventory operations and lead assigned employees during the second shift.
  • Train new department personnel and support team members with technical issues.
  • Manage SKU creation, updates, edits, and activation status in the ERP system.
  • Run ERP reports to resolve open and overdue orders, pick lists, and material issues.
  • Oversee damaged material handling, department KPIs, audits, stock transfer orders, cycle counts, and pick lists.
  • Pull and stage materials, conduct physical inventory counts, reconcile discrepancies, and improve inventory procedures.

Requirements

  • High school diploma or equivalent.
  • At least four years of experience in inventory, shipping and receiving, logistics, or a related field.
  • Experience leading employees, prioritizing tasks, and delegating work is preferred.
  • Familiarity with cycle counting, picking and posting, and MRP/ERP systems.
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Word, Excel, and Outlook, with strong communication, analytical, organizational, and problem-solving skills.
  • Ability to operate powered equipment, including forklifts and scissor lifts, and lift, push, or pull up to 35 pounds.

Culture & Benefits

  • Medical, dental, and vision insurance plans.
  • Life insurance and short- and long-term disability coverage.
  • Matching 401(k) contributions.
  • Vacation, paid sick time, and tuition reimbursement.
  • PPE is required on the production floor, including gloves, safety glasses, a hard hat, and ear protection.
